Your marketing campaigns are absolutely dependent upon autoresponders to work properly. It is at this point that your sales channel starts and it is also where you have the opportunity to check on your prospects and follow up with them later. Studies have shown that a person needs to be exposed to an offer some 7 times before they will actually take any action about it. And you have to be consistent. You will need to build a relationship of trust by offering real and valuable content through the use of email messages sent to your prospects. Do not make your e-mails long with content, instead you need to get straight to the point in short paragraphs. Since to goal is make sure they remember you, they should be sent out in intervals of 2 to 3 days. You really run the risk of being labeled as spam if you rarely approach your prospects with your emails, you definitely don’t want to lose customers to inconsistency. However, you really don’t want to overwhelm your prospects by sending too many email messages, as they may unsubscribe from your list, again something you do not want.

The first step towards being successful with an autoresponder is to choose the right one. An autoresponder is usually a fairly simple program which works by making your e-mail marketing efforts automatic. You should find one which meets the specific needs of your business. If you want, you can put this program into your own servers and do your own hosting. If you lack the necessary programming skills in order to do this, then you will have to hire somebody who does. You may encounter some bugs and will need to backup all your data, if this sounds too complicated for you then you will certainly need to outsource to somebody with better understanding. It’s certainly possible to do this, but rather than dedicate time to maintenance of your autoresponder, you should improve other aspects of your business. With this the case a lot of people get third party autoresponder services to run their autoresponder. With this option, all you have to do is set your messages to go out on the autoresponder. You pay a simple monthly fee to the autoreponder service rather than wasting time and money hosting everything yourself.

Don’t forget that there’s also a wide variety of style options available for your opt-in forms. Opt-in forms are those forms filled out by people who are then added to your contact list. The only two bits of information you really need is name and email address, however you can choose to get more than this is you wish. This is why you should make sure your opt-in form is good. Perform some research so you will know what the proper fields are to include for your effort. Make things easy and provide only one choice – opt in or get out. Creating your autoresponder messages is also an important element of achieving success with your email marketing campaign.
In order to get your visitor’s contact information such as their name and email address, you have to bribe them with a free report, video, or anything that can deliver value. You must give them a reason to part from their contact info. Your first automated message should live up to your promise. The second, third and fourth messages should be used to talk about relevant, helpful ideas that your potential customers can actually use. You shouldn’t start any promotion until your fifth message, but it shouldn’t be a pushy sales message; rather, it should be something like a product review. Next, you just need to repeat the cycle and make a few adjustments. You can plan as many as 100 messages for your autoresponder to be delivered at your planned time interval. Being successful takes time and effort, anything that can help you streamline the process is obviously hugely beneficial to you, the autoresponder is one such thing.
